multiple choice: choose the best answer.

  1. which of the following is not a major difference between a prokaryotic and eukaryotic cell?

a. prokaryotic cells are simple, while eukaryotic are complex.
b. prokaryotic cells have a flagella to move it, while eukaryotic cells do not.
c. prokaryotic cells have cytoplasm, while eukaryotic cells do not.
d. prokaryotic cells are very small, while eukaryotic cells are typically much larger and complex.

  1. what is the main purpose of the membrane in a eukaryotic cell?

a. to provide the cell with energy
b. to let substances in and out
c. to make the things cells need to function
d. to clean up a cell

  1. which of the following best completes the analogy?

lysosome : vacuum cleaner :: nucleus : --------------------
a. skin
b. water
c. brain
d. factory

  1. what is the authors main purpose in writing this selection?

a. to explain how the human body is composed of cells.
b. to entertain the reader with an interesting story about cells.
c. to persuade the reader to become a biologist who studies cells.
d. to inform the reader of what a cell is and its various parts.

  1. the flagella are whip - like appendages that help the cell move. not all prokaryotic cells have flagella.

what is the best meaning of appendages in the previous quote?
a. something connected to another thing that is more important
b. a projecting part that is attached to something else
c. a person who is dependent on someone else
d. a larger part of something

Explanation:

Brief Explanations
  1. Both prokaryotic and eukaryotic cells have cytoplasm. Prokaryotic cells are simple and small, eukaryotic are complex and larger. Some eukaryotic cells (like sperm) have flagella.
  2. The membrane in a eukaryotic cell controls the movement of substances in and out (selective permeability). Mitochondria provide energy, ribosomes make needed things, lysosomes clean.
  3. Lysosome is like a vacuum cleaner (cleans). Nucleus is like a brain (controls cell activities).
  4. The text likely aims to inform about cells (their types, parts etc. as per questions 11 - 13 context).
  5. Flagella are attached (projecting) parts (whip - like) that help movement. “Appendages” mean a projecting part attached to something else.

Answer:

  1. C. Prokaryotic cells have cytoplasm, while eukaryotic cells do not.
  2. B. To let substances in and out.
  3. C. Brain.
  4. D. To inform the reader of what a cell is and its various parts.
  5. B. A projecting part that is attached to something else.
